云服务器怎么搭建数据库,云服务器数据库搭建全攻略,从零开始构建稳定高效的数据平台
- 综合资讯
- 2024-12-03 03:20:09
- 2

云服务器数据库搭建攻略,从零开始构建稳定高效数据平台。涵盖搭建步骤、优化技巧,助您快速掌握云数据库部署,实现数据安全与性能提升。...
云服务器数据库搭建攻略,从零开始构建稳定高效数据平台。涵盖搭建步骤、优化技巧,助您快速掌握云数据库部署,实现数据安全与性能提升。
随着互联网的快速发展,企业对数据库的需求日益增长,云服务器因其便捷、高效、可扩展的特点,成为企业搭建数据库的首选平台,本文将详细讲解如何在云服务器上搭建数据库,包括准备工作、安装配置、优化调优等环节,帮助您轻松构建稳定高效的数据平台。
准备工作
1、选择合适的云服务器
您需要选择一款适合自己的云服务器,目前市场上主流的云服务器提供商有阿里云、腾讯云、华为云等,在选择云服务器时,需要考虑以下因素:
(1)性能:根据企业需求选择合适的CPU、内存、存储等硬件资源。
(2)稳定性:选择有良好口碑的云服务器提供商,确保服务器稳定运行。
(3)安全性:云服务器需具备较高的安全性,防止数据泄露和恶意攻击。
(4)价格:根据企业预算选择性价比高的云服务器。
2、准备数据库软件
根据您的需求选择合适的数据库软件,如MySQL、Oracle、SQL Server等,下载并安装对应的数据库软件。
安装配置
1、登录云服务器
使用SSH客户端(如Xshell、PuTTY等)登录到云服务器。
2、安装数据库软件
以MySQL为例,执行以下命令安装:
sudo apt-get update sudo apt-get install mysql-server
3、配置数据库
(1)设置root密码
sudo mysql_secure_installation
根据提示设置root密码,并确认是否删除匿名用户、禁止root远程登录、禁止空密码登录等。
(2)配置MySQL服务
编辑/etc/mysql/my.cnf
文件,修改以下配置:
[mysqld] bind-address = 0.0.0.0 port = 3306
(3)重启MySQL服务
sudo systemctl restart mysql
优化调优
1、优化数据库配置
(1)调整缓冲池大小
[mysqld] innodb_buffer_pool_size = 128M
(2)调整日志文件大小
[mysqld] log_error = /var/log/mysql/error.log max_error_size = 1024M
(3)调整连接数
[mysqld] max_connections = 1000
2、优化数据库性能
(1)定期备份数据库
使用mysqldump
工具备份数据库:
mysqldump -u root -p -P 3306 database_name > backup.sql
(2)监控数据库性能
使用SHOW PROCESSLIST
命令查看数据库连接数、查询时间等信息,分析数据库性能瓶颈。
(3)优化SQL语句
分析SQL语句,优化查询逻辑,提高查询效率。
本文详细介绍了在云服务器上搭建数据库的步骤,包括准备工作、安装配置、优化调优等环节,通过学习本文,您将能够轻松构建稳定高效的数据平台,为企业的业务发展提供有力支持,在实际应用中,请根据企业需求不断优化数据库配置,提高数据库性能。
本文链接:https://zhitaoyun.cn/1277962.html
发表评论